Putting oil on some salad bowls for the first sale in a couple of weeks,
when, horrors! Down in the transition from wall to bottom, half-hidden in
the annual rings, was a heel mark. You know, the ones where the back of the
bevel burnished its way around while you were concentrating on the front.

Not a problem. Went back to the lathe, chucked the bowl in the recess and
hit the entire inside with 150/220/320. As I applied the fresh oil with my
3M synthetic wool, I noticed how the segment was now a match for its
surroundings. No low spots, either, since I was able to sand with the piece
rotating.
